Course Overview
The Civil Engineering (PhD) program at Georgia Institute of Technology is designed to develop advanced research skills and expertise in civil engineering disciplines. The program emphasizes innovative solutions to infrastructure challenges, sustainable design, and cutting-edge technologies. Students engage in rigorous research under the guidance of renowned faculty, contributing to advancements in areas such as structural engineering, transportation systems, environmental engineering, and geotechnical engineering.
